The SMPP Load Balancer Proxy (SLBP) proxies SMPP submit_sm requests to your platforms. SMPP binds are made from the SLBP to your platforms using the customer's SMPP credentials, and only SMS traffic sent by that customer is routed to your platforms using their credentials. Delivery receipts and MO SMS are routed back to the customer as though they had directly connected to your platforms. No customer accounts need to be configured in the SLBP unless routing based on customer system ID. Only the host and port for each of your platforms are required to be configured in the SLBP.

What resources and capacity do I get on the t3.small hourly instance?
You run one t3.small compute instance billed per hour. This configuration supports up to 1000 SMS per second and connects to as many as 50 upstream SMPP servers. TLS is optionally supported. You pay only for the hours the instance runs.
Am I charged when the instance is stopped or idle?
Hourly software charges apply only while the t3.small instance runs. If you stop the instance, the hourly software charge stops. Underlying AWS storage or other resource fees may still apply while the instance is stopped. Billing tracks running time, not message volume.
Does message throughput affect my hourly cost?
No. Your charge is based on instance-hours, not on how many messages you send. The t3.small instance supports up to 1000 SMS per second. Sending fewer or more messages within that limit does not change your hourly rate.

The following example adds two target SMPP servers (smsc1.smpp.org and smsc2.smpp.org) to where each customer's SMS traffic will be load balanced.
SSH to your SLBP instance (or use AWS EC2 Instance Connect from your browser) as user ec2-user.
Add first target SMPP server: ./ec2MLSMPPLoadBalancer targetAdd smsc1 smsc1.smpp.org
Add second target SMPP server: ./ec2MLSMPPLoadBalancer targetAdd smsc2 smsc2.smpp.org
Restart the SLBP: sudo systemctl restart mlslbp
Your customers can now connect using SMPP to port 2775 on your SLBP instance.
Login to the SLBP configuration portal (GUI) at http://SLBHOST/portal. SLBHOST is the SLBP instance hostname. The credentials for using the GUI and API default to "slbpuser" for the client ID and the AWS EC2 instance ID for the password (e.g. i-092bxxe40xxc1f2xx).
